Frequently Asked Questions
Common questions about dermatology services in Aberdeen, Washington
How can I find a dermatologist in Aberdeen, Washington, and are there many options locally?
While Aberdeen itself has a limited number of dedicated dermatology clinics, residents typically access care through nearby providers in Grays Harbor County or neighboring cities like Olympia. It's recommended to check with major local healthcare providers like Grays Harbor Community Hospital or Summit Pacific Medical Center for referrals, and many patients also find dermatologists in Hoquiam or schedule appointments with specialists who visit the area on certain days.
What are the most common dermatology services available at clinics in or near Aberdeen?
Dermatology services accessible to Aberdeen residents generally include skin cancer screenings (especially important in the Pacific Northwest), treatment for acne and eczema, management of psoriasis, and removal of benign growths like moles and skin tags. Given the region's climate, expertise in treating sun damage and providing cosmetic procedures like Botox or laser treatments for sun spots is also commonly available through visiting specialists or nearby clinics.
What should I know about insurance and payment when seeing a dermatologist in the Aberdeen area?
Most dermatology practices in the Grays Harbor area accept major insurance plans like Premera, Regence, and Medicare, but it's crucial to verify coverage directly with the clinic before your appointment. For those without insurance, many offices offer self-pay discounts or payment plans; it's advisable to inquire about these options when scheduling, especially at local practices like those affiliated with Summit Pacific Medical Center.
Are wait times for dermatology appointments long in Aberdeen, and how can I schedule one?
Due to the limited number of specialists in the immediate area, new patient appointments for non-urgent dermatology care in Aberdeen can have wait times of several weeks to a few months. To schedule, contact clinics directly or ask your primary care physician at a local practice like Aberdeen Family Medicine for a referral, which can sometimes expedite the process for concerning skin issues.
Is there emergency dermatology care available in Aberdeen for severe issues like a spreading rash or possible skin infection?
For true dermatological emergencies, such as a severe allergic reaction or rapidly spreading infection, the Emergency Department at Grays Harbor Community Hospital in Aberdeen is the primary resource. For urgent but non-life-threatening issues like sudden severe rashes, contact your primary care provider or an urgent care clinic in Aberdeen first, as they can often provide initial treatment and a referral to a dermatologist.
